The evangelical church of St. Cyriakus in Kellinghusen dates back to the 13th century and has been expanded and modified several times. After a fire, the interior was completely redesigned in the 1970s according to designs by Hans Kock. https://www.architektur-bildarchiv.de/image/St.-Cyriacus-Kirche-Kellinghusen-75474.html

There are over 220 running routes available around Auufer, offering a wide variety of options for joggers of all fitness levels. These routes have been explored by more than 1900 runners using komoot.
The jogging trails around Auufer feature a diverse mix of surfaces. You can expect to find paved paths, gravel sections, asphalt, and natural trails, providing variety for different running preferences and experiences.
Yes, Auufer offers several easy running routes suitable for beginners or those looking for a relaxed jog. There are 30 easy routes available. An example is the Running loop from Kellinghusen, which is 2.7 miles (4.4 km) long and takes about 27 minutes to complete.

Yes, many of the running routes in Auufer are designed as loops, perfect for those who prefer circular trails. For instance, the Running loop from Wittenbergen is a popular 5.1-mile (8.3 km) circular trail.
The running routes in Auufer are highly regarded by the komoot community, holding an average rating of 4.3 stars from over 120 reviews. Runners often praise the varied terrain and the accessible options for different ability levels.
Yes, you can discover several interesting points of interest near the running routes. These include natural features like Lohmühlenteich and the Waldsee Spring and Picnic Area. You might also encounter historical sites such as the Stellau Fieldstone Church.
Absolutely. For those seeking a greater challenge, Auufer offers 25 difficult routes and 174 moderate routes. A good option is the Running loop from Auufer, which covers 7.4 miles (11.9 km) and features moderate elevation changes.
Yes, some routes offer scenic views along waterways. The Siphon at the Stör – Old Town Hall loop from Kellinghusen is a moderate 6.3-mile (10.1 km) path that combines natural riverside sections with other local sights.
